Executive Assistant Confidential Charlotte, NC 28214 Our client is a leading manufacturing company in the Charlotte area. They are currently seeking an organized and proactive Executive Assistant to provide comprehensive administrative support to their executive team in a fast-paced manufacturing environment. The ideal candidate will be highly detail-oriented, have exceptional organizational skills, and possess the 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ously. The Executive Assistant will serve as a critical point of contact for internal and external stakeholders, while assisting in managing daily operations and projects within the manufacturing sector.

Medical, dental and vision insurance plans 401K Retirement Plan Paid vacation and holidays Excellent training Great team-oriented work environment Growth opportunities Executive Assistant Responsibilities include: Provide high-level administrative assistance to President & CEO, including calendar management, meeting scheduling, travel arrangements, and personal routine. Coordinate meetings, prepare agendas, take minutes, and follow up on action items. Serve as the primary point of contact between the executives and internal/external stakeholders, handling inquiries and requests efficiently. Assist with the management and execution of special projects within the manufacturing division. Support the tracking and reporting of project progress, ensuring that milestones are met. Prepare, proofread, and edit correspondence, presentations, and reports for executives. Act as a liaison for the executive team, ensuring clear communication between departments and external partners. Handle confidential and sensitive information with discretion and professionalism. Organize and maintain filing systems (both electronic and physical). Monitor and respond to emails and phone calls on behalf of the executives. Support the executive team with operational tasks, such as reviewing reports, vendor coordination, and supply chain management activities. Book travel, accommodation, and transportation for the executive team, ensuring the most cost-effective and efficient arrangements. Track and manage expenses, ensuring compliance with the company’s budgetary policies. Complete a variety of special projects including creating PowerPoint presentations, financial spreadsheets, special reports, and agenda material. Other additional and/or alternative duties as assigned from time to time, including supporting other departments or Executives as needed.

Executive Assistant Qualifications include:

Bachelor’s degree in business administration is strongly preferred. Three to five years prior executive administrative experience in supporting a senior executive team. Excellent computer skills, including Microsoft Office Suite (Outlook, Word, PowerPoint, and Excel). ERP- Sage 100 and Nulogy experience preferred. Comfortable interacting with high-level executives. Someone who exhibits sound judgment with the ability to prioritize and make decisions. Energetic and eager to tackle new projects and ideas. A team player capable of cultivating productive working relationships across the organization. Must be able to work independently, be resourceful, and have a can-do attitude. Exceptional writing, editing, and proofreading skills. Excellent organization and time-management skills. Must have a strong sense of urgency. Must be able to work effectively and efficiently with all cross functional teams. Excellent communication skills required.
